#include <complex.h> | |
#include <fenv.h> | |
#include <math.h> | |
#include "math_private.h" | |
__complex__ long double | |
__cexpl (__complex__ long double x) | |
{ | |
__complex__ long double retval; | |
int rcls = fpclassify (__real__ x); | |
int icls = fpclassify (__imag__ x); | |
if (rcls >= FP_ZERO) | |
{ | |
/* Real part is finite. */ | |
if (icls >= FP_ZERO) | |
{ | |
/* Imaginary part is finite. */ | |
long double exp_val = __ieee754_expl (__real__ x); | |
long double sinix, cosix; | |
__sincosl (__imag__ x, &sinix, &cosix); | |
if (isfinite (exp_val)) | |
{ | |
__real__ retval = exp_val * cosix; | |
__imag__ retval = exp_val * sinix; | |
} | |
else | |
{ | |
__real__ retval = __copysignl (exp_val, cosix); | |
__imag__ retval = __copysignl (exp_val, sinix); | |
} | |
} | |
else | |
{ | |
/* If the imaginary part is +-inf or NaN and the real part | |
is not +-inf the result is NaN + iNaN. */ | |
__real__ retval = __nanl (""); | |
__imag__ retval = __nanl (""); | |
#ifdef FE_INVALID | |
feraiseexcept (FE_INVALID); | |
#endif | |
} | |
} | |
else if (rcls == FP_INFINITE) | |
{ | |
/* Real part is infinite. */ | |
if (icls >= FP_ZERO) | |
{ | |
/* Imaginary part is finite. */ | |
long double value = signbit (__real__ x) ? 0.0 : HUGE_VALL; | |
if (icls == FP_ZERO) | |
{ | |
/* Imaginary part is 0.0. */ | |
__real__ retval = value; | |
__imag__ retval = __imag__ x; | |
} | |
else | |
{ | |
long double sinix, cosix; | |
__sincosl (__imag__ x, &sinix, &cosix); | |
__real__ retval = __copysignl (value, cosix); | |
__imag__ retval = __copysignl (value, sinix); | |
} | |
} | |
else if (signbit (__real__ x) == 0) | |
{ | |
__real__ retval = HUGE_VALL; | |
__imag__ retval = __nanl (""); | |
#ifdef FE_INVALID | |
if (icls == FP_INFINITE) | |
feraiseexcept (FE_INVALID); | |
#endif | |
} | |
else | |
{ | |
__real__ retval = 0.0; | |
__imag__ retval = __copysignl (0.0, __imag__ x); | |
} | |
} | |
else | |
{ | |
/* If the real part is NaN the result is NaN + iNaN. */ | |
__real__ retval = __nanl (""); | |
__imag__ retval = __nanl (""); | |
#ifdef FE_INVALID | |
if (rcls != FP_NAN || icls != FP_NAN) | |
feraiseexcept (FE_INVALID); | |
#endif | |
} | |
return retval; | |
} | |
weak_alias (__cexpl, cexpl) |
